Title: Brett Alan Ireland: Innovator in Virtual Prediction Technologies
Introduction
Brett Alan Ireland is a notable inventor based in Santa Clara, CA. He has made significant contributions to the field of computer science, particularly in the area of virtual prediction technologies. His innovative work has led to the development of a unique patent that enhances the efficiency of processing instructions in computing systems.
Latest Patents
Brett holds a patent for a technology titled "Virtual 3-way decoupled prediction and fetch." This invention introduces a unified queue designed to perform decoupled prediction and fetch operations. The unified queue consists of multiple entries, each capable of storing information related to at least one instruction. This information includes an identifier portion, a prediction information portion, and a tag information portion. The queue is engineered to update the prediction information in response to a prediction block and to adjust the tag information based on a tag and TLB block. Notably, the prediction information can be updated multiple times, and the system is designed to take corrective actions when later predictions conflict with earlier ones.
